第一种:
<Img|x=0|y=0|width=<$SCREENWIDTH>|height=<$SCREENHEIGHT>|scale9r=12|scale9t=12|show=4|bg=1|img=custom/demo1/bg_main_6.png|scale9b=12|scale9l=1|layerid=1000>
<Layout|children={texiao,1,2,3,4,5,6,7,8,9,10,11,12}|a=4|percentx=50|percenty=50
🤖 回答引擎: TXT语法专家 |
🕒 时间: 2026-03-31 12:51:23 |
👁️ 阅读: 1
第一种写法使用了`scale9`参数(scale9l、scale9r、scale9t、scale9b)和`percentx`、`percenty`,这表示图片会进行九宫格拉伸以适应不同屏幕分辨率,并通过`percentx=50`、`percenty=50`将容器居中。`layerid=1000`设置了层级。
第二种写法是传统的固定坐标定位,使用具体的`x`、`y`坐标值(如x=714.0)来放置关闭按钮和点击区域,没有使用九宫格拉伸和百分比居中。
作用上,第一种更适合需要自适应屏幕的界面,能保证在不同分辨率下显示效果一致。第二种在固定分辨率下布局精确,但可能在不同屏幕上出现位置偏差。
优劣取决于需求:如果需要响应式布局,第一种更优;如果界面设计固定且不考虑多分辨率适配,第二种写法更直接简单。
← 返回问答库